Output 152e5533819861854c172e9c82fbe843b143dff8f3faf6dbae0d98d72c636e4c:31

value
24256
script pubkey
OP_0 OP_PUSHBYTES_20 79bf8b8b6a7c06253caaf4bbb19679e21cb107a0
address
bc1q0xlchzm20srz20927jamr9neugwtzpaq3jh2rw
transaction
152e5533819861854c172e9c82fbe843b143dff8f3faf6dbae0d98d72c636e4c
confirmations
57772
spent
true